Headline Analysis:
There are two camps here. One side (CNN, Vox) wants you to know Trump messed up “bigly” regarding Puerto Rico. He wasn’t there fast enough. He didn’t show enough compassion. He insulted them. You get the idea. They want to focus on the fact that Trump said it wasn’t a “real catastrophe, like Katrina”.
The other side (Fox News, NY Post) are not so hard on POTUS. Despite his poor choice of words, he does have a point — 1,800 deaths in Katrina is >>>>> than the 34 so far in Puerto Rico. This is not to undermine the massive infrastructure damage. Other nice things were said by the prez which were absent in major headlines.
